Nettet2. mar. 2024 · To be diagnosed with restless legs syndrome, someone must experience a strong urge to move their legs. The urge to move their legs must also be : Accompanied by or caused by uncomfortable and unpleasant sensations in the legs. Worse when sitting or lying down. Worse at night compared with during the day. Nettet11. des. 2024 · Sitting this way can help you prevent your leg from shaking. Additionally, it sends the message to your body that you are relaxed. Nettet26. mai 2024 · Symptoms. The most common symptom of orthostatic hypotension is lightheadedness or dizziness when standing after sitting or lying down. Symptoms usually last less than a few minutes. Orthostatic hypotension signs and symptoms include: Lightheadedness or dizziness upon standing. Blurry vision. Weakness. Nettet1. mar. 2024 · Restless legs syndrome (RLS) is a condition that causes an uncontrollable urge to move the legs, usually because of an uncomfortable sensation. It typically happens in the evening or nighttime hours when you're sitting or lying down. Moving eases the unpleasant feeling temporarily.
